37 /*
38 * The PCI interface treats multi-function devices as independent
39 * devices. The slot/function address of each device is encoded
40 * in a single byte as follows:
41 *
42 * 7:3 = slot
43 * 2:0 = function
44 *
45 * PCI_DEVFN(), PCI_SLOT(), and PCI_FUNC() are defined in uapi/linux/pci.h.
46 * In the interest of not exposing interfaces to user-space unnecessarily,
47 * the following kernel-only defines are being added here.
48 */
49 #define PCI_DEVID(bus, devfn) ((((u16)(bus)) << 8) | (devfn))
50 /* return bus from PCI devid = ((u16)bus_number) << 8) | devfn */
51 #define PCI_BUS_NUM(x) (((x) >> 8) & 0xff)

601
602
603 /*
604 * PCI Error Recovery System (PCI-ERS). If a PCI device driver provides
605 * a set of callbacks in struct pci_error_handlers, that device driver
606 * will be notified of PCI bus errors, and will be driven to recovery
607 * when an error occurs.
608 */
609
610 typedef unsigned int __bitwise pci_ers_result_t;
611
612 enum pci_ers_result {
613 /* no result/none/not supported in device driver */
614 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NONE =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 1,
615
616 /* Device driver can recover without slot reset */
617 PCI_ERS_RESULT_CAN_RECOVER =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 2,
618
619 /* Device driver wants slot to be reset. */
620 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NEED_RESET =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 3,
621
622 /* Device has completely failed, is unrecoverable */
623 PCI_ERS_RESULT_DISCONNECT =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 4,
624
625 /* Device driver is fully recovered and operational */
626 PCI_ERS_RESULT_RECOVERED =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 5,
627
628 /* No AER capabilities registered for the driver */
629 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NO_AER_DRIVER =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 6,
630 };
631
632 /* PCI bus error event callbacks */
633 struct pci_error_handlers {
634 /* PCI bus error detected on this device */
635 pci_ers_result_t (*error_detected)(struct pci_dev *dev,
636 enum pci_channel_state error);
637
638 /* MMIO has been re-enabled, but not DMA */
639 pci_ers_result_t (*mmio_enabled)(struct pci_dev *dev);
640
641 /* PCI Express link has been reset */
642 pci_ers_result_t (*link_reset)(struct pci_dev *dev);
643
644 /* PCI slot has been reset */
645 pci_ers_result_t (*slot_reset)(struct pci_dev *dev);
646
647 /* PCI function reset prepare or completed */
648 void (*reset_notify)(struct pci_dev *dev, bool prepare);
649
650 /* Device driver may resume normal operations */
651 void (*resume)(struct pci_dev *dev);
652 };

1546 #endif /* HAVE_ARCH_PCI_RESOURCE_TO_USER */
1547
1548
1549 /*
1550 * The world is not perfect and supplies us with broken PCI devices.
1551 * For at least a part of these bugs we need a work-around, so both
1552 * generic (drivers/pci/quirks.c) and per-architecture code can define
1553 * fixup hooks to be called for particular buggy devices.
1554 */
1555
1556 struct pci_fixup {
1557 u16 vendor; /* You can use PCI_ANY_ID here of course */
1558 u16 device; /* You can use PCI_ANY_ID here of course */
1559 u32 class; /* You can use PCI_ANY_ID here too */
1560 unsigned int class_shift; /* should be 0, 8, 16 */
1561 void (*hook)(struct pci_dev *dev);
1562 };
1563
1564 enum pci_fixup_pass {
1565 pci_fixup_early, /* Before probing BARs */
1566 pci_fixup_header, /* After reading configuration header */
1567 pci_fixup_final, /* Final phase of device fixups */
1568 pci_fixup_enable, /* pci_enable_device() time */
1569 pci_fixup_resume, /* pci_device_resume() */
1570 pci_fixup_suspend, /* pci_device_suspend() */
1571 pci_fixup_resume_early, /* pci_device_resume_early() */
1572 pci_fixup_suspend_late, /* pci_device_suspend_late() */
1573 };
